[QUOTE="Helmuts, post: 2374364, member: 322934193"] Morning, The bottom price for 2-letter .com's is 600k USD (usually would be paid by 1 domain name investor to another one) Can you share is it a .com, .net, some other gtld, or some country extension (all 2-letter domain extensions are country extensions. .co -Colombia, .de - Germany, .co.uk UK and so on)? Also, is it a combination of a number + letter? is there a hyphen in the middle? .. don't tell us the name > extension and its structure would be enough for the beginning. You can check the previous publicly reported sales at namebio.com - have you tried it before? You would probably need to start from there. Best! H [/QUOTE]
